Really 3.5 -The bar is very elegant. If you have been to the Bad Luck Bar or Johnny’s I would recommend visiting this bar at least once. The service is mixed depending on whose working. The cocktails are decent. This place is quite fabulous in it’s own way, but I believe the drinks need more flourish and/or flair(presentation) especially considering their prices and what their competition offers in the same price range. I do think the cocktail menu should be updated with some newer options to show a better variety. At this point they have no issues with traffic due to it’s aesthetic and the fact that it’s connected to the Siren Hotel. It’s nice to have a nice bar inside a trendy hotel. For that reason I think it will stay busy for a while, but as other competitive bars(including high end bars connected to hotels) continue to grow I think they may need to eventually introduce some changes. In relation to its size, yes it is small but most exclusive or high end bars are. In addition there are bars in Detroit that are smaller. I will say it is very whimsical inside. It is vintage with mid century influences and a lot of pink. The aesthetic itself is worth a visit. You may luck out with a seat or two from walking in but it is usually hard to get in that way even with a small party. I would highly recommend making a reservation well in advance. I will say that I have had complications with reservations in the past. I do feel like some parties are rushed because other parties linger too long or the restaurant double books. It’s important for that reason to book well in advance and call the day of as well. I will definitely go back if I’m staying in the hotel or in the area.
